5FA1

The structure of the beta-3-deoxy-D-manno-oct-2-ulosonic acid transferase domain of WbbB

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sCLSI BEAMLINE 08ID-1
Synchrotron siteCLSI
Beamline08ID-1
Temperature [K]100
Detector technologyCCD
Collection date2015-07-10
DetectorRAYONIX MX-300
Wavelength(s)0.97949
Spacegroup nameC 2 2 21
Unit cell lengths92.750, 159.390, 120.040
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ution48.046 - 2.100
R-factor0.173
Rwork0.171
R-free0.20990
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)5fa0
RMSD bond length0.005
RMSD bond angle0.827
Data reduction softwareXDS
Data scaling softwareXSCALE
Phasing softwarePHASER
Refinement softwarePHENIX (1.9_1692)

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P5.529310 mg/ml WbbB, 0.2 M NaCl, 0.1M Bis-Tris, 25% PEG 3350, 1 mM TCEP, 1mM CMP
